summaryrefslogtreecommitdiff
path: root/dict.go
diff options
context:
space:
mode:
authorÖzgür Kesim <oec@codeblau.de>2024-06-06 14:18:33 +0200
committerÖzgür Kesim <oec@codeblau.de>2024-06-06 14:18:33 +0200
commitf4ea425e9e00d9e3b1efc2a0493c82c6e08866c1 (patch)
tree48a1e42123bdb39453a8a50da242899b761a56d5 /dict.go
parent73ceb1844b0ce94255148c4821b42ced1605596f (diff)
add user-agent headerHEADmaster
Diffstat (limited to 'dict.go')
-rw-r--r--dict.go8
1 files changed, 7 insertions, 1 deletions
diff --git a/dict.go b/dict.go
index 9721269..302fc62 100644
--- a/dict.go
+++ b/dict.go
@@ -31,7 +31,13 @@ func main() {
fromto = os.Args[2] + "."
}
- r, err := http.Get("http://" + fromto + BASE + url.QueryEscape(os.Args[1]))
+ req, err := http.NewRequest("GET", "https://"+fromto+BASE+url.QueryEscape(os.Args[1]), nil)
+ if err != nil {
+ panic(err)
+ }
+ req.Header.Add("User-Agent", "Mozilla/5.0 (X11; Linux x86_64; rv:126.0) Gecko/20100101 Firefox/126.0")
+ r, err := http.DefaultClient.Do(req)
+
if err != nil {
println("error:", err.Error())
return